What Blade Types Are Best for Lawn Mower Choppers?

The best lawn mower chopper blade types include:

  • Standard Blades: These are the most common type of mower blades and are designed for a clean cut of grass. They provide a good balance between performance and ease of maintenance, making them suitable for regular lawn care.
  • Mulching Blades: These blades are specifically designed to chop grass clippings into finer pieces, allowing them to decompose quickly and return nutrients to the soil. They have a curved design that creates a swirling effect, which enhances the mulching process.
  • High-Lift Blades: High-lift blades are engineered with a greater angle on the blade tips, allowing for increased airflow and lifting of grass clippings. This design is ideal for mowing thick grass or when you want to bag the clippings efficiently.
  • Low-Lift Blades: These blades have a flatter design and are best for cutting softer grass types or when a clean cut is desired without excessive lift. They are less likely to clog, making them suitable for wet or damp conditions.
  • Gator Blades: Gator blades combine features of both mulching and standard blades, often featuring a design that allows for efficient mulching and cutting. They are versatile and can handle various types of grass while providing excellent performance.

What Types of Lawn Mower Choppers Are Available and Which Are Most Effective?

The main types of lawn mower choppers available include:

  • Rotary Mowers: These are the most common type of lawn mowers that use a horizontal blade to chop grass.
  • Reel Mowers: These manual mowers use a cylindrical blade system that cuts grass in a scissor-like motion.
  • String Trimmers: Also known as weed eaters, these tools use a rotating nylon string to cut grass and weeds in tight areas.
  • Ride-On Mowers: These are larger, tractor-like machines designed for extensive lawns, featuring powerful choppers that effectively handle thicker grass.
  • Robotic Mowers: These automated devices operate independently to cut grass, using advanced technology to navigate and adjust to various lawn conditions.

Rotary Mowers: Rotary mowers are equipped with a sharp blade that spins horizontally beneath the mower deck, effectively cutting grass as it moves forward. They are versatile and can handle different grass types, making them suitable for most residential lawns.

Reel Mowers: Reel mowers feature a set of rotating blades that cut grass by trapping it between the blades and a stationary bed knife. They provide a clean cut and are often preferred for small yards or gardens, particularly for those who prefer an eco-friendly option since they require no fuel.

String Trimmers: String trimmers complement traditional mowers, allowing users to reach areas that are difficult to access, such as along fences and around trees. They are effective for trimming grass and weeds but are not designed for cutting large areas of lawn.

Ride-On Mowers: These mowers are ideal for large properties, featuring a powerful engine and a wide cutting deck that can efficiently manage extensive grassy areas. They also come with various attachments for additional tasks like mulching or bagging clippings.

Robotic Mowers: Robotic mowers are an innovative solution for lawn care, utilizing sensors and GPS technology to autonomously navigate and mow the lawn. They can be programmed for specific cutting schedules and are particularly effective in maintaining a consistently manicured lawn without requiring manual operation.

How Can You Maintain Your Lawn Mower Chopper for Optimal Performance?

To maintain your lawn mower chopper for optimal performance, consider the following practices:

  • Regular Cleaning: Keeping your lawn mower clean is essential for its longevity and performance. After each use, remove grass clippings, dirt, and debris from the deck and blades to prevent rust and corrosion.
  • Blade Sharpening: Sharp blades ensure a clean cut for your grass, promoting healthier growth. Aim to sharpen the blades at least once a season or more frequently if you mow regularly, as dull blades can damage your lawn and require more effort to operate.
  • Oil Changes: Regular oil changes are crucial for the engine’s performance and longevity. Check the oil level before each use and change it according to the manufacturer’s recommendations, typically every 25 hours of operation or once a season.
  • Air Filter Maintenance: A clean air filter allows your engine to breathe properly and run efficiently. Inspect the air filter regularly and clean or replace it as necessary to avoid engine damage and ensure optimal performance.
  • Fuel System Care: Using fresh fuel and adding a fuel stabilizer can prevent issues in the fuel system. Empty the fuel tank if storing the mower for an extended period and refill with fresh gas before the mowing season begins.
  • Check Spark Plug: The spark plug is vital for engine ignition and performance. Inspect the spark plug regularly, clean it if necessary, and replace it if it shows signs of wear or damage to ensure smooth engine operation.
  • Tire Maintenance: Proper tire inflation is important for even cutting and maneuverability. Regularly check the tire pressure and inspect for any signs of wear or damage, addressing any issues to maintain optimal performance.
  • Belts and Cables Inspection: Inspecting belts and cables for wear and tear can prevent unexpected breakdowns. Replace any frayed or damaged belts and cables to ensure reliable operation and safety during mowing.

What Common Problems Do Lawn Mower Chopper Owners Face and How Can They Be Fixed?

Common problems faced by lawn mower chopper owners include:

  • Engine Starting Issues: Difficulty in starting the engine is a prevalent concern among lawn mower chopper users, often caused by stale fuel or a clogged air filter.
  • Blades Not Cutting Properly: Dull or damaged blades can lead to uneven cutting, which may require sharpening or replacement to ensure a smooth lawn finish.
  • Overheating: Mowers can overheat due to lack of oil, clogged cooling fins, or prolonged use, which can be mitigated by regular maintenance and allowing the engine to cool down.
  • Fuel Leaks: Fuel leaks can occur due to damaged fuel lines or gaskets, and these should be addressed immediately to prevent fire hazards and ensure efficient operation.
  • Electrical Problems: Issues with the ignition system or battery can result in starting failures, typically resolved by checking connections and replacing faulty components.

Engine starting issues often arise from stale fuel, which can lead to poor combustion, or a clogged air filter that restricts air flow. Regular maintenance, including using fresh fuel and replacing filters, can help prevent these problems.

Blades not cutting properly is a common issue that can result in uneven grass height and stress on the mower. Ensuring that blades are sharp and in good condition is essential for optimal performance, and this may require regular sharpening or replacing them as needed.

Overheating can occur from insufficient oil levels, which leads to increased friction in the engine, or from debris clogging the cooling fins. To prevent overheating, it is vital to regularly check the oil and clean the cooling system of any grass or dirt buildup.

Fuel leaks pose a significant risk as they can lead to fires and inefficient operation. Regularly inspecting fuel lines and gaskets for wear and replacing them can effectively minimize this risk.

Electrical problems, such as issues with the ignition system or battery, can prevent the mower from starting altogether. Regularly checking the battery charge and ensuring all electrical connections are secure can help avoid these frustrating situations.
